Selecting the Correct Gas Regulator

A gas regulator is a important component in any system that uses compressed gas. It regulates the pressure of the gas as it flows through lines, ensuring safe and consistent operation. With a wide selection of types available, selecting the right gas regulator can seem daunting.

  • To begin, consider the type of fluid you will be controlling.
  • Next, determine the required level.
  • In addition, think about the application of the regulator.

By carefully evaluating these factors, you can select a gas regulator that fulfills your specific needs and provides safe and efficient performance.

Understanding Gas Flow Regulation

A reliable flow regulator unit is essential for optimizing gas delivery in various applications. It ensures a stable supply of fuel at the desired pressure. Without a robust regulator, fluctuations in gas pressure can lead to erratic operation, potentially compromising safety.

  • Properly functioning regulators prevent pressure spikes, which can result in serious damage.
